The game introduces the "Form Baton" (Wii Remote), requiring players to hold the controller in various positions, including "The Waiter," "The Umbrella," "The Samurai," and "The Elephant" (holding it up to your nose).

In the early days of Wii homebrew, games were stored as massive files, which took up a full 4.37 GB of storage regardless of how much data the game actually used. Because WarioWare: Smooth Moves is a fast-paced game built on short microgames, its actual data size is much smaller than a full DVD.

WarioWare: Smooth Moves is arguably one of the most innovative and entertaining titles released for the Nintendo Wii. Released in 2006/2007 as a launch-window title, it perfectly showcased the potential of the Wii Remote, pushing players to twist, turn, shake, and hold the controller in absurd ways to beat hundreds of lightning-fast microgames.

WarioWare: Smooth Moves is a party game developed by Intelligent Systems and published by Nintendo for the Wii console. Released in 2007, the game is the ninth installment in the WarioWare series. Players use the Wii Remote to perform a variety of motion-based mini-games, each with its own unique gameplay mechanics. The game features a colorful cast of characters, including Wario, Waluigi, and Mona, as they compete in a series of wacky challenges.
